Are you able to sue a landlord for accidents? Indeed, you could sue a landlord for injuries that you simply suffer in a collision within the premises. You are able to convey a personal personal injury declare that attempts to confirm the landlord’s liability, ordinarily underneath the speculation of carelessness. Which means that the landlord was to blame for the region the place the accident happened or the issue that induced the incident, but they didn't consider realistic treatment in addressing it. The accident also will have to are already a foreseeable result.

Less than state legislation, California landlords will have to disclose distinct information to tenants (normally in the lease or rental arrangement), which include whether the fuel or electricity while in the tenant's rental also serves other locations and information regarding harmful mold If your landlord knows that mildew around the property exceeds publicity boundaries or poses a threat for the tenant's health.
